FDA Panel OKs Compounding Six Popular Peptides — Experts Weigh Risks, Benefits

A federal advisory panel recently recommended that pharmacists be allowed to compound six popular peptides — meaning they could legally mix these drugs on a pharmacy-by-pharmacy basis instead of patients only getting factory-made versions. The panel wasn’t deciding final law, but its opinion matters because it guides what regulators and lawmakers might allow. The story is about whether these medicines should be easier to get through local compounding pharmacies or kept under stricter manufacturing rules. One of the things being discussed are peptides. In plain terms, peptides are tiny proteins — short chains of amino acids — that can act like signals in the body. Some of the peptides in question are used for things like weight loss or blood-sugar control. A common example people have heard of is semaglutide, the active ingredient in Ozempic and Wegovy, which copies a natural gut hormone that tells your brain you’re full and slows stomach emptying. Compounded peptides are the same kind of molecule, but mixed and packaged at a pharmacy rather than made by a large drug company. The research and evidence considered by the advisers varied by peptide. For some, there are clinical trials showing how they work and what side effects to expect. For others, evidence is thinner — small studies, early human trials, or animal data. The panel weighed safety records, whether the drugs are made commercially, and how well pharmacists can reliably prepare the doses. They noted differences in how much is known about long-term effects, and that compounding can introduce variability in dose and purity. In short: some peptides have solid trial data; others are farther from definitive proof, and the studies were not all large or long-term. This matters because compounded availability could make these treatments easier and sometimes cheaper to get. People who need these medicines but can’t access brand-name products — for cost, supply, or prescribing reasons — could benefit. It could also spur innovation in how doctors tailor doses to individual patients. On the flip side, wider compounding could mean more variability in what patients receive, so outcomes might not match the results seen in formal clinical trials. There are important caveats and risks. Compounded drugs don’t go through the same manufacturing oversight, batch testing, or labeling standards as FDA-approved products, so purity and exact dosing can vary. Side effects reported for peptide drugs include digestive issues, headaches, injection-site reactions, and for some agents, more serious but rarer risks. People with certain conditions, or who are pregnant or breastfeeding, should be cautious; always discuss with a doctor before using a compounded peptide. Regulators will still need to set rules to limit unsafe practices and ensure pharmacies follow quality standards. Bottom line: The advisers opened the door for pharmacists to compound six peptides, which could expand access but also raises real questions about evidence, consistency, and safety that patients and doctors should watch closely.
